Open fSpy and drag your background plate into the viewport.
For example, if your top-down photo shows a rectangular table, you would:
If you only need to match a single shot and want zero hassle with scripts, you can read fSpy's calculated parameters directly from the fSpy UI and type them into 3ds Max.
To help refine your workflow, how do you plan to handle lighting for this project? If you want, tell me if you are using , and whether you plan to use an HDRI dome or native 3ds Max lights . Share public link fspy 3ds max top
Search repositories like GitHub or ScriptSpot for "fSpy to 3ds Max importer." These scripts read the JSON-formatted data inside or alongside the fSpy project.
Camera matching is one of the most critical steps in visual effects, architectural visualization, and 3D compositing. Aligning a 3D camera to a 2D background plate manually can take hours of frustrating guesswork. Fortunately, , an open-source, standalone camera calibration software, solves this problem with mathematical precision.
Fortunately, you do not have to abandon 3ds Max to benefit from fSpy's sub-pixel accuracy. This guide covers the top three workflows to bridge the gap between fSpy and 3ds Max, ensuring your architectural visualizations and VFX composites line up flawlessly every single time. Direct Workflow Comparison Setup Complexity Medium (Requires Blender installed) Complex 3-point perspectives 2. Manual Parameter Copying Low (No extra plugins needed) Quick projects or restricted pipelines 3. Max Native "Perspective Match" Low (No external software) Straightforward 2-point architectural shots Method 1: The Blender FBX Bridge (Most Accurate) Open fSpy and drag your background plate into the viewport
Go to the menu (the little hammer icon or Scripting > Run Script ). Navigate to your camera_data.ms and run it.
: Press 8 to open the Environment and Effects window and load your image as the Environment Map. Use Alt+B to set it as the viewport background.
Run the script in 3ds Max and select your .fspy file to generate the camera and backplate automatically. 2. Manual Data Entry (Universal Method) If you want, tell me if you are
: By defining a reference distance in fSpy (e.g., the width of a standard door), you can ensure the imported camera scale matches real-world units in 3ds Max. Lens Estimation
Install the latest version from the fSpy website. Load Image: Drag and drop your photo into the fSpy window.
When matching a standard horizontal shot, fSpy relies on vanishing points. You draw lines along the X, Y, and Z axes, and the software calculates the camera rotation. This works beautifully for buildings or eye-level still lifes.